How much resolution does a 5 megapixel camera have?

For example, a 2 megapixel camera actually captures 1,920,000 pixels per frame. A 3 megapixel camera captures 3,145,728 pixels per frame….Most Popular CCTV Resolutions.

Term Pixels (W x H) Notes
4 MP 2688 x 1520 4 Megapixel
5 MP 2592 x 1944 5 Megapixel
6 MP 3072 x 2048 6 Megapixel
8 MP / 4K (Coax) 3840 x 2160 8 Megapixel

Is 5 megapixels better than 1080p?

5 megapixel is gaining more momentum but 1080p is still the most popular right now as it seems to be a good balance of video quality and economical storage cost. Another consideration is that 5 megapixel resolution is not 16:9 aspect ratio, it is 5:4 aspect ratio.

What resolution is 3 megapixel?

3 Megapixel Security Cameras are network based surveillance cameras that provide video resolution of 2048 x 1536 pixels over a digital signal using CAT5e/CAT6 cabling.

What is the resolution of a 2 megapixel camera?

Any resolution over 1 million pixels is considered ‘megapixel’. In the case of megapixel cameras, the labels are approximate. For example, a 2 megapixel camera actually captures 1,920,000 pixels per frame. A 3 megapixel camera captures 3,145,728 pixels per frame.

What’s the difference between a megapixel and a MP?

MP refers to the megapixel, which is the measurement of a camera’s resolution. 1 megapixel is the equivalent of 1 million pixels. So the higher the megapixel count (1MP, 2MP, etc.), the better the resolution the camera has. What’s the difference between the 4MP and 8MP?
